Banco do Brasil advances in the carbon credits market by introducing a combination of technology and analysis. The bank's own platform provides customers with the necessary guidance to identify the potential of their properties for producing carbon credits.
This way, customers can be connected to specialized climatetechs. For this guidance, the customer does not need to make a monetary payment, as the service is compensated in carbon credits.
Gustavo Lellis, director of supplies, infrastructure and assets at Banco do Brasil, emphasizes: “we aim to help our clients explore the green market and recognize the opportunities available. Our objective is to stimulate the entire carbon chain, integrating technology and our renowned experience in ESG, which has led us to be considered the bank with the greatest global sustainability in recent years.”
Since May, the Bank has been accepting carbon credit certificates as a means of payment. This option is valid for the bank's rural properties sold at auction or directly on the website seuimovelbb.com.br.
The credits obtained, both in the payment of rural properties and in the consultancy provided, will be used to offset greenhouse gas emissions resulting from the bank's activities. These actions are part of Banco do Brasil's strategy to encourage the transition to a zero-carbon economy and combat climate change, as each carbon credit produced represents one less ton of carbon dioxide in the atmosphere.
The solutions are displayed at Febraban Tech, which takes place in São Paulo, from June 27th to 29th. A totem will be available for participants to navigate, providing an interactive journey on the topic, with the assistance of bank employees.
The journey is organized into sections that clarify how Banco do Brasil transforms data into sustainable businesses. Furthermore, anyone interested can learn about this topic step by step and even express interest in the operation by filling out a form for the bank's future contact.
